In 1842, Susan Elizabeth Child entered the world in Granville, Putnam, Illinois, USA, born to David Lorenzo Child And Margaret Longwell. Susan Elizabeth Child married Ninian Alfonso Mccord, and had children including Charles Cornelius Mccord, Frank P Mccord, Orin L Mccord, Warren C Mccord, Wilmot J Mccord. Susan Elizabeth Child passed away in 1930 in East Lynn, Vermilion County, Illinois, United States of America.
